Big National Brands Have Just Discovered Drag Queens

Nine West recently launched a game show called "What Would You Do For Shoe?," which stars RuPaul's Drag Race phenomenon Manila Luzon. It takes place in Times Square, and includes an extra element of drag—one portion of the contest involves dressing up the contestant's boyfriends.

Earlier this summer, Old Navy did something sort-of similar: Pandora Boxx and Delta Work, also of Drag Race fame, promoted the brands $1 flip-flops outside the Sixth Avenue store in Chelsea. And exactly a year ago, Cole Haan enlisted a handful of drag queens to dance in sensible flats in Williamsburg.

So what's happening here—did someone just get Logo? Or are we mourning the loss of Splash?
